#295bc9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#295bc9 is composed of 16.1% red, 35.7%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.6% cyan, 54.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 221.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 47.5%. #295bc9 color hex could be obtained by blending #52b6ff with #000093.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#295bc9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#295bc9 has RGB values of R:41, G:91,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 2710473.
